Fulham defenders Tim Ream and Antonee Robinson have been named in Gregg Berhalter’s 23-man United States squad for the conclusion of the CONCACAF Nations’ League next month.

The States take on Bobby De Cordova-Reid’s Jamaica in the semi-final in Texas on Thursday 21 March and will be hoping to reach the final, which will take place in the early hours of Monday 25 March UK time.
